Description

As of February 22, 2023, the project was awarded in August 2022, and is under construction. An exact timeline for construction has not been confirmed. Question Cut Off May 26, 2022 @5:00pm The project scope includes construction of a new public plaza with amenities, located between Arlington City Hall Building and Arlington's Downtown Public Library (George W. Hawkes Library Building). The project includes, 40' tall architectural clock tower (with artwork), architectural water feature, seating areas, specialty paving, landscape improvements, site improvements and construction of all supporting appurtenances. This project is seeking to memorialize a historical landmark, the Mineral Well, that was torn down in 1951. Memorializing this well provides a platform to tell the story of one of city's most foundational places, now lost in time and makes a connection with this historic landmark. The project goal is to provide a gathering place for the community, through construction of public plaza and create a strong focal point for the view looking eastward down W.
